Introduction: Until now, hypertension is still a major disease in Indonesia. Hypertension is a condition that is often found in primary health care. This hypertension is a health problem with a high prevalence of 25.8%, the Indonesian population suffers from hypertension. Methods: The type of research used is descriptive analytical with a correlational design that examines relationships between variables. By used a cross sectional approach. The sample size in this study according to Slovin could be determined by a formula based on the population in getting 80 samples. The sampling technique used in this study is Simple Random Sampling. The independent variable in this study was family support. While the dependent variable in this study is the obedience of elderly people with hypertension in undergoing treatment for hypertension. The statistical test used is the Pearson Product Moment correlation test with ? = 0.05. Results and Analysis: Family support for elderly people with hypertension in the Gemarang Community Health Center, Madiun Regency obtained an average of 76.86, a median of family support of 79.05. Compliance with the elderly at the Gemarang Health Center in Madiun Regency obtained an average score of 89.76. There is a relationship between family support and adherence of elderly patients in undergoing hypertension treatment in Madiun District Health Center with p-value = (0,000) <? (0.05) and r value = 0.623 which means the two variables have a strong relationship.
